A Study of Two Different Dose Combinations of Nivolumab in Combination With Ipilimumab in Subjects With Previously Untreated, Unresectable or Metastatic Melanoma

ClinicalTrials.gov ID: NCT02714218

Official title

Phase IIIb/IV, Randomized, Double Blinded, Study of Nivolumab 3 mg/kg in Combination With Ipilimumab 1 mg/kg vs Nivolumab 1 mg/kg in Combination With Ipilimumab 3 mg/kg in Subjects With Previously Untreated, Unresectable or Metastatic Melanoma

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

The purpose of this study is to evaluate two different dose combinations of nivolumab and ipilimumab in the treatment of melanoma.
